Wildfire in France triggers pyrocumulonimbus cloud and new fires

What happened

A wildfire in southwest France produced a smoke column that developed into a thunderstorm. This phenomenon created lightning that caused additional fires in the vicinity, according to French officials.

Why it matters

This event highlights the increasing intensity of wildfires and their potential to cause further fire outbreaks.
